MAN 6200
Project Leadership with Project Management Professional Prep
Yeshiva University · UGRD · Fall 2026
Catalog description
Students will be equipped with advanced knowledge and practical skills in project management while preparing to sit for the Project Management Professional (PMP) exam. Students will explore the full project lifecycle with emphasis on integrating scope, schedule, cost, quality, risk, and stakeholder management. Through case studies, simulations, and applied exercises, students will use industry-standard tools and methodologies aligned with the Project Management Institute framework. The course blends theory with hands-on practice, enabling students to lead complex projects, demonstrate cross-functional leadership, and apply PMI standards and ethics to real-world business challenges.
